3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The idea: Words next to the unknown word can be a clue that there is a synonym.
Ex: Discrimination or bias can cause distress toward the targeted people.
Back
Synonym
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The idea: Providing examples of the unknown word can give readers a clue to meaning.
Ex: Vulnerable people, such as young children, the elderly, or handicapped individuals, might have protections under certain laws.
Back
Example
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The idea: Look for the grammatical structure of appositives which can provide definition, synonym, or example.
Ex: Discrimination, the act of showing bias to one group, can have damaging effects.
Back
Appositive
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The idea: Comparisons of the word help to determine what it means.
Ex: The ill effects of discrimination are like hateful, wicked tendrils gripping the heart.
Back
Analogy
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The idea: Opposite information about unknown word can be offset by words and phrases such as unlike, as opposed to, different from.
Ex: Discrimination, as opposed to fairness for all people, can have damaging effects on a targeted group.
Back
Antonym / Contrast
